Senior Director - Enterprise Infrastructure & Cybersecurity (Kennesaw, GA)

Remote, USA Full-time
About the position The Senior Director of Enterprise Infrastructure, Cybersecurity and Support will be responsible for overseeing the global strategy, management, and delivery of sustainable IT infrastructure and cybersecurity operations across the organization. This role will also lead the strategic ownership of Global IT Support, ensuring seamless follow-the-sun support across US, EMEA, and APAC regions. With a focus on strengthening cybersecurity resilience, system hardening, and redundancy for critical systems, the director will drive initiatives to enhance the IT infrastructure team's capabilities while managing the infrastructure and security technology roadmaps. The position will work closely with the VP of Global IT and other IT directors to align infrastructure and cybersecurity strategies with business objectives, ensuring robust, scalable, and secure operations globally. Responsibilities • Develop and execute the global strategy for IT infrastructure and cybersecurity, ensuring alignment with business goals and industry best practices. • Take strategic ownership of Global IT Support, ensuring the delivery of efficient, high-quality support services across multiple global sites. • Drive initiatives to strengthen cybersecurity resilience, focusing on threat prevention, detection, and response. • Lead efforts to enhance system hardening, improve security controls, and implement redundancy strategies for critical systems. • Manage the development and execution of the cybersecurity and infrastructure technology roadmap for the next 3-5 years. • Oversee the development and strengthening of the IT infrastructure team, ensuring the team has the necessary skills and training. • Manage relationships with external vendors, including 24/7 Security Operations Centers (SOC) and virtual Chief Information Security Officers (vCISO). • Provide leadership in establishing and maintaining best practices for global IT support. • Ensure compliance with relevant industry regulations, including GDPR, ISO 27001, NIST, and others. • Lead the response to critical security breaches, IT incidents, or service outages. • Work directly with the VP of Global IT and other IT directors to align infrastructure and cybersecurity strategies with overall business priorities. • Manage the budgeting process for global IT infrastructure and cybersecurity initiatives. Requirements • 10+ years in IT leadership roles with proven experience in managing global IT infrastructure and cybersecurity operations. • Deep knowledge of key technologies such as Cisco switches, Palo Alto firewalls, WAN, Crowdstrike, and Cisco Global Protect VPN. • Experience in leading cybersecurity initiatives, including system hardening and disaster recovery. • Strong experience in managing external vendors and stakeholders in a complex global environment. • Proven ability to manage the technology roadmap for infrastructure and cybersecurity. Nice-to-haves • Master's degree in a relevant field (e.g., MBA, MS in Cybersecurity, or Information Systems). • Relevant certifications such as CISSP, CISM, CISA, or ITIL. Apply tot his job
